Default Hello World :)

Just thought I would drop in and make a first post. I've just turned a quarter of a century old and finally have my own place with a decent backyard and such. I guess you could say I have been bitten by the plant bug now.

I just recently bought two young nanners, a musa "double mahoi" and a "basjoo". Since I got them just a month or so ago, they have been putting out a new leaf or two on a weekly basis, unlike most of my palms that grow very slow. I went ahead and brought them in from the upcoming winter, which isn't too bad here (zone 8b), but I can tell that the growth has slowed down since we had our first night in the 50's a week ago.

Anyway, check out my gallery, I added a few of my new additions. Happy nannering yall....
